SUSTAINABLE FLOORING CHOICE FOR NEW SECONDARY SCHOOL Designed as an educational facility for secondary grade students, The Arcadia Secondary School is a new purpose-built school adjacent to The Arcadia Preparatory School. Echoing the school’s bright, safe and sustainable design, Milliken’s Culture Canvas carpet tiles were chosen for the Arcadia school library.

The campus covers a total teaching space of 6000m2, including the classrooms, shared learning and labs. Other facilities within the campus include a library, music and dance rooms that together cover an area of 1500m2.
Internally, classrooms are bright with ample daylight and with large corridors providing social spaces for children. Recreational play areas include a soccer pitch and sports courts, multipurpose hall and swimming pool, which
are provided on different levels of the building. The school is designed in line with sustainable building practices to provide an optimally safe, healthy, comfortable and productive learning environment for students and a pleasant working environment for faculty and staff. Arcadia School is the second in a series of community-based schools delivering the vision of Mohan Valrani and the Al Shirawi Group. The Arcadia School’s secondary campus is the second school designed and built by Godwin Austen Johnson (GAJ) Architects as part of a series of community-based schools for Arcadia Education. Located within Dubai’s Jumeirah Village Triangle, close to the primary school, the orientation of the new secondary campus and the functions within it have been optimised to exploit the view out over the central Jumeirah Village Triangle Park. Drawing inspiration from The Arcadia School’s primary campus, the reception is bright and airy, opening out into a large casual seating zone with a unique 12m-high indoor climbing wall feature. The new secondary school features a full-sized artificial pitch, a 25m swimming pool and MUGA court, which can be accessed by the primary school when required.
